Renée Zellweger: A Glimpse into Her Life

Renée Zellweger, born in Katy, Texas, on April 25, 1969, has, you know, charmed audiences for decades. Her acting career took off in the 1990s, and she quickly became a household name. She has a way of bringing characters to life that really sticks with people, honestly.

Her work often gets a lot of praise, and she has, in fact, won some of the biggest awards in the film world. People remember her for her ability to play both comedic and serious roles, showing a pretty wide range as an actor. She is, for example, someone who always seems to give her all to a part.

Here are some personal details and biographical facts about Renée Zellweger:

Full NameRenée Kathleen Zellweger
Date of BirthApril 25, 1969
Place of BirthKaty, Texas, U.S.
OccupationActress, Producer
Notable RolesBridget Jones (Bridget Jones's Diary series), Roxie Hart (Chicago), Ruby Thewes (Cold Mountain), Judy Garland (Judy)
AwardsAcademy Awards, Golden Globe Awards, BAFTA Awards, Screen Actors Guild Awards

What People Noticed

When the photos from the 2014 event circulated, many observers pointed to changes around her eyes and forehead. Her eyes, which had always had a somewhat distinctive hooded look, appeared more open and bright. This particular change, in fact, seemed to be the most talked about aspect.

Some people thought her face looked smoother, too. They questioned if she had undergone any cosmetic work. The internet, as you know, quickly filled with side-by-side comparisons of her past and present photos. It was, honestly, quite a frenzy of speculation.

Her Own Words on the Changes

Renée Zellweger herself addressed the public's comments about her appearance. She wrote an essay for The Huffington Post in 2016, where she spoke about the rumors and the scrutiny. She wanted, in a way, to set the record straight on some things.

In her essay, she made it quite clear that she had not had any surgery to change her eyes. She stated that the speculation was "nonsense." She explained that her different look was due to a few factors, including feeling happier and healthier in her life. She was, you know, living a different kind of life at that time.

She wrote about living a more fulfilling life and taking better care of herself. This, she suggested, made her look different. She also talked about the importance of self-acceptance and focusing on what truly matters. Her words, in fact, gave a lot of people something to think about.

She said, and I'm paraphrasing here, that she was glad people thought she looked different. She saw it as a sign that she was living a more joyful and peaceful life. It was, apparently, a sign of her own personal growth. You know, she really just wanted to live her life.

Her piece also touched on the broader issue of how society treats women's appearances, especially as they get older. She called out the harmful nature of such public discussions and the pressure to meet certain beauty standards. It was, in some respects, a very powerful message.

She expressed concern about the message this kind of scrutiny sends to younger generations. She felt it promoted an idea that a woman's worth is tied to her physical appearance. That, you know, is a pretty important point to make.

Addressing the "Surgery" Question Directly

So, to get right to the point: What surgery did Renée Zellweger have? According to Renée Zellweger herself, she did not have surgery to change her eyes or face. She has stated, quite clearly, that the rumors of her having gone under the knife are not true. Her own words are, in fact, the most direct answer we have.

She attributes any noticeable changes to natural aging, feeling more content, and living a healthier life. She has explained that being out of the public eye for a bit allowed her to focus on herself. This period, in some respects, led to a different outlook and, perhaps, a different look.
